CodeDependency is a plugin for IntelliJ-based IDEs that helps developers inspect and visualize relationships between code elements. It supports code dependency analysis within desktop development environments.
In the Other dev tools space, CodeDependency takes a focused approach. It focuses on understanding and navigating dependencies between code elements in IntelliJ-based projects. CodeDependency is a B2B product aimed at software developers using IntelliJ-based IDEs. CodeDependency is free to use. CodeDependency is available on the web, macOS, Windows, and Linux.
Behind CodeDependency is JetBrains Marketplace, and it first shipped in 2007. Among its 4 catalogued features are dependency visualization, code analysis, and dependency navigation.
